# Chittoor Sub-Division Enforces Strict Public Assembly Curbs Through August 31

Law enforcement authorities in Chittoor have activated Section 30 of the Police Act to regulate public gatherings and maintain order. The restrictions require prior official clearance for any political or social demonstrations across fourteen police jurisdictions.

## Security Measures Activated Across Multiple Jurisdictions

In a move to preempt civil unrest and secure public safety, Chittoor police authorities have implemented prohibitory orders under Section 30 of the Police Act. These restrictions, which became effective on August 2, will remain in force until August 31 throughout the entire Chittoor sub-division. Deputy Superintendent of Police J. Venkatanarayana confirmed the measure following instructions from Superintendent of Police Tushar Dudi.

## Restricted Activities and Geographic Scope

The directive mandates that individuals and organizations obtain formal permission before organizing any large-scale events. The following activities are prohibited without explicit prior approval:
- Public meetings and political rallies
- Street demonstrations and dharnas
- Road blockades and protest marches

The enforcement zone is extensive, covering fourteen distinct police station areas. These include Chittoor I and II towns, Chittoor taluk, G.D. Nellore, N.R. Peta, Penumuru, and Yadamari. Additionally, the mandate extends to Gudipala, Thavanampalle, Kanipakam, Puthalapattu, Irala, Kallur, and Rompicherla.

## Enforcement and Legal Consequences

Deputy SP Venkatanarayana issued a formal warning stating that the department will pursue legal action against any person or group found in violation of these standing orders. The administration has requested that residents and community leaders cooperate with law enforcement to ensure communal harmony and local security during this period.
